The PIC12F1571-I/P belongs to the category of microcontrollers.
This microcontroller is commonly used in various electronic devices and embedded systems for controlling and managing functions.
The PIC12F1571-I/P is available in a 8-pin DIP (Dual Inline Package) format.
The essence of the PIC12F1571-I/P lies in its ability to provide efficient control and processing capabilities in a compact package, making it suitable for a wide range of applications.
